Sourcebae helps companies hire top Beego developers faster by connecting them with pre-vetted, interview-ready talent. Get access to the top 1% of Beego experts in days, not months.

150+ brands trust and use Sourcebae to power their hiring processes

Builds and maintains robust backend systems using Ruby for scalable applications. Known for writing clean, maintainable code and solving complex engineering problems.
Manages LLM infrastructure and deployment pipelines with a focus on stability and performance. Ensures AI systems run efficiently from development to production.
Supports business analysis with structured thinking and data-backed insights. Helps teams make informed decisions through clear documentation.
Contributes to LLM training with a focus on agent workflows and function calls. Helps bridge real-world application logic with AI behavior through structured agent function calling.
Specializes in training AI models through detailed video annotation workflows. Plays a key role in improving model accuracy using high-quality visual data.
Let us source, vet, and match you with top developers — ready to join your team fast.

Struggling to find the right Beego developers? Follow this step-by-step hiring guide to streamline your recruitment and secure top talent efficiently.
Access top-tier, pre-vetted ready-to-be-hired Python developers. Whether you need onsite, hybrid, or remote talent.
No more screening 100s of resumes! Handpick your preferred candidates and have our AI fast-track schedule and conduct interviews for you!
Access our global pool of 500k+ pre-vetted extensive talents and save up to 92% hiring costs compared to traditional hiring.
Get hands-on help from our team of experienced whenever needed and hire Python Programmers confidently.
At Sourcebae, we assist you in overcoming the number one challenge when it comes to hiring: finding the right talent. Here’s how you can effortlessly hire with us:

A Beego developer specializes in using the Beego framework, which is a powerful and efficient web application framework for the Go programming language. This framework provides a robust set of features, including an MVC architecture, built-in ORM, and a comprehensive set of tools for routing, session management, and RESTful API development. Beego developers are skilled in creating scalable and high-performance web applications, leveraging Go's concurrency features for optimal performance. They are also adept at utilizing Beego's extensive documentation and community support to solve complex problems and implement best practices. Overall, a Beego developer plays a crucial role in modern web development projects.
Beego developers play a crucial role in building web applications using the Beego framework, a powerful and efficient tool in the Go programming language ecosystem. Their expertise allows them to create robust and scalable applications by leveraging Beego's features such as MVC architecture, RESTful API support, and built-in ORM. A Beego developer not only writes code but also collaborates with cross-functional teams to gather requirements, design software solutions, and ensure high-performance applications. They stay updated with the latest trends in Go and web development to implement best practices and optimize applications for user experience and security.
Here are five reasons why Beego is in demand
Beego supports rapid development with its comprehensive features and built-in functionalities. A Beego developer can quickly create robust applications using the framework’s modular architecture, which allows for reusable components. This efficiency not only saves time but also enables developers to focus on enhancing functionality and improving user experience.
Beego is known for its strong performance capabilities, making it ideal for building high-performance applications. It boasts a lightweight framework that minimizes resource consumption. A Beego developer can leverage these features to create applications that handle large traffic volumes efficiently, ensuring quick response times and reduced latency.
With RESTful API support, Beego allows developers to easily build services that can interact with various clients. A Beego developer can utilize its straightforward routing and controller mechanisms to create scalable APIs, simplifying the server-client communication process and promoting seamless integration with other systems and platforms.
Beego comes with a variety of built-in tools and libraries, creating an extensive ecosystem that enhances developer productivity. A Beego developer benefits from these resources, such as ORM Object-Relational Mapping and task scheduling, which streamline the development process and reduce the need for third-party integrations, leading to more efficient project management.
The Beego framework has an active and supportive community, providing resources, plugins, and ongoing updates. A Beego developer can tap into this community for troubleshooting, best practices, and collaboration opportunities. This ensures developers stay informed about the latest features and enhancements, fostering continuous learning and improvement.
When you choose to hire Beego developers, you are tapping into a pool of professionals who possess in-depth knowledge of the Beego framework. Beego is known for its simplicity and efficiency in building web applications. Developers specialized in this framework understand its components, including the MVC architecture, routing, and RESTful APIs. Their expertise ensures that your application is not only built to be functional but also scalable and maintainable. Experienced Beego developers can leverage the framework’s features to create robust applications that meet your specific requirements.
One of the significant advantages of hiring Beego developers is their ability to accelerate the development process. Beego supports rapid development, allowing developers to create prototypes quickly. This is particularly beneficial for startups and businesses looking to introduce their products to the market swiftly. When you hire Beego developers, they can utilize the framework’s built-in tools and libraries to streamline various development tasks, significantly reducing the time it takes to move from concept to deployment. This ensures that your project stays on schedule and within budget.
The Beego framework boasts a vibrant community of developers who contribute to its continuous improvement. By hiring Beego developers, you gain access to professionals who are well-connected within this community. They can leverage community resources, such as libraries, plugins, and forums, to solve complex problems and enhance your application. This support network also means that your developers can stay updated on the latest trends and best practices within the Beego ecosystem. As a result, your project benefits from innovative solutions and increased reliability, ensuring that it remains competitive in a fast-paced market.
When it comes to web applications, performance and security are paramount. Beego developers are trained to optimize applications for speed and efficiency, utilizing the framework's features to enhance performance. They can implement caching strategies and asynchronous processing to ensure that your application runs smoothly, even under heavy loads. Moreover, security is a critical concern for any application. Hiring Beego developers means you are engaging professionals who understand the best security practices associated with the framework. They can implement security measures to protect your data and ensure compliance with industry standards, safeguarding your application against potential threats.
Every business is unique, requiring customized solutions that cater to specific challenges and goals. Hiring Beego developers allows you to create a tailored application that aligns with your business objectives. These developers can work closely with your team to understand your vision and translate it into a functional application using the Beego framework. Their ability to customize features and integrate third-party services means you can create a product that not only meets your immediate needs but also adapts to future growth. By hiring Beego developers, you ensure that your application is flexible, scalable, and capable of evolving alongside your business. In summary, choosing to hire Beego developers equips your project with the right skill set, enabling you to harness the full potential of cross-platform development while optimizing costs and timelines for your applications.
Beego is a powerful, open-source web framework for Go Golang that streamlines the development of robust, scalable web applications and RESTful APIs. Hiring pre-vetted Beego developers ensures your projects are managed by professionals who have demonstrated expertise in Go, MVC architecture, and cloud-native best practices. This approach accelerates development, reduces risk, and results in high-performance, maintainable solutions ready to support your business growth.
1. Full-Stack Go Expertise Access developers skilled in leveraging Go’s speed and efficiency throughout the stack.
2. MVC Architecture Proficiency Benefit from well-structured, maintainable codebases using Beego’s MVC design principles.
3. Rapid API Development Get robust, RESTful APIs quickly built with Beego’s out-of-the-box tools and features.
4. Automated Routing & URL Management Work with experts in Beego’s automated routing for clean, user-friendly URLs and efficient request handling.
5. Integrated ORM Support Enjoy seamless database integration and management with Beego’s built-in ORM.
6. Built-In Session & Caching Leverage advanced session management and caching for faster, more reliable web applications.
7. Comprehensive Testing & Debugging Hire developers adept in Beego’s integrated testing and debugging tools for robust, bug-free releases.
8. Cloud-Native & Scalable Solutions Build apps optimized for cloud deployment and effortless scaling as your needs evolve.
9. Security Best Practices Rely on professionals experienced in secure coding, input validation, and session management.
10. Immediate Project Impact Onboard pre-vetted Beego developers who are ready to deliver results from day one, minimizing ramp-up and accelerating project delivery.
When seeking to hire Beego developers, it's essential to narrow down your options effectively to find the right fit for your project. Beego, an efficient web application framework for Golang, requires specific skills and experience. Here are some key pointers to consider during your selection process.
Beego is an extensive framework for building web applications in Go, suitable for various applications, from simple websites to complex API servers. Its rich ecosystem includes several tools and frameworks that enhance the development process. If you want to accelerate your development, consider to hire Beego developers who can leverage these tools effectively.
When planning to hire Beego developers, it is important to evaluate specific technical skills that ensure they can build scalable, high-performance applications. Below are key skills to look for in a Beego developer.
A strong grasp of Go language fundamentals is essential when you hire Beego developers. Developers must understand Go's syntax, concurrency model, and standard libraries. Familiarity with Go routines, channels, and interfaces allows developers to build efficient, scalable, and maintainable applications. Mastery of Go ensures developers can leverage Beego's full potential, optimizing performance and reliability.
Hire Beego developers who possess deep expertise in the Beego framework itself. They should understand Beego's MVC architecture, routing mechanisms, session management, and middleware integration. Developers must efficiently utilize Beego's built-in tools, such as Bee CLI, to streamline development processes, automate tasks, and enhance productivity.
Effective database management is crucial when you hire Beego developers. They should be proficient in working with relational databases like MySQL, PostgreSQL, and SQLite, as well as NoSQL databases such as MongoDB. Developers must understand ORM Object-Relational Mapping techniques provided by Beego, enabling efficient data modeling, querying, and optimization for improved application performance.
Hire Beego developers who excel in designing and implementing RESTful APIs. They should understand HTTP methods, status codes, request-response structures, and JSON/XML data formats. Developers must ensure APIs are secure, scalable, and maintainable, adhering to best practices for versioning, authentication, and documentation, thus facilitating seamless integration with frontend applications and third-party services.
When you hire Beego developers, ensure they possess skills in frontend integration and collaboration. Developers should comfortably work alongside frontend teams, integrating Beego backend services with frontend frameworks like React, Angular, or Vue.js. Familiarity with AJAX, JSON data handling, and cross-origin resource sharing CORS ensures smooth communication between frontend and backend components.
Hire Beego developers who demonstrate strong testing and debugging skills. They should be proficient in writing unit tests, integration tests, and end-to-end tests using Go's testing libraries and frameworks. Developers must efficiently identify, diagnose, and resolve bugs, ensuring application stability, reliability, and high-quality code delivery throughout the development lifecycle.
Effective use of version control systems like Git is essential when you hire Beego developers. Developers should understand branching strategies, merging, conflict resolution, and code reviews. Familiarity with collaboration tools such as GitHub, GitLab, or Bitbucket ensures smooth teamwork, efficient code management, and streamlined development workflows, enhancing overall project productivity.
Hire Beego developers who prioritize security best practices. They should understand common web vulnerabilities, including SQL injection, cross-site scripting XSS, and cross-site request forgery CSRF. Developers must implement secure coding practices, input validation, authentication mechanisms, and encryption techniques, ensuring robust protection of sensitive data and safeguarding applications against potential threats.
When you hire Beego developers, ensure they possess deployment and DevOps knowledge. Developers should be familiar with containerization technologies like Docker, orchestration tools such as Kubernetes, and cloud platforms including AWS, Azure, or Google Cloud. Understanding continuous integration and continuous deployment CI/CD pipelines enables developers to automate deployments, streamline updates, and maintain application scalability and reliability in production environments.
When considering the hiring of a Beego developer, various pricing structures and team arrangements impact your project's success. Knowing the costs associated with these developers can save you time and budget.
1.1 Junior Beego Developer $25 - $40 per hour
Junior developers are often fresh graduates or those with less experience in the Beego framework. They can execute straightforward tasks under supervision, making them a cost-effective choice for basic projects.
1.2 Mid-Level Beego Developer $40 - $70 per hour
Mid-level developers possess a solid understanding of Beego and can handle moderate complexities and contribute independently. They are perfect for teams needing someone who can work with minimal guidance.
1.3 Senior Beego Developer $70 - $100+ per hour
Senior developers are seasoned professionals with extensive expertise in the Beego framework. They can tackle complex projects, lead teams, and provide strategic insights, justifying their higher hourly rates.
2.1 Junior Beego Developer $4,000 - $6,500 per month
While more affordable, hiring a junior developer for a full month allows you to train them and have them integrated into the team gradually.
2.2 Mid-Level Beego Developer $6,500 - $10,000 per month
This investment works well for mid-level developers who can manage tasks effectively and require less supervisory effort.
2.3 Senior Beego Developer $10,000 - $15,000 per month
The cost reflects the value of having a senior-level developer who can ensure your project’s technical architecture is sound and mentors the junior and mid-level developers.
3.1 Junior Team 3 developers $12,000 - $18,000
Ideal for startups or smaller projects where budget constraints are a concern, having multiple juniors can promote rapid learning across the team.
3.2 Mixed Team 1 Senior, 2 Mid-Level $20,000 - $30,000
This structure offers a balance, combining mentorship from a senior developer with the strength of two mid-level developers working on more complex tasks.
3.3 Full Team 1 Senior, 2 Mid-Level, 2 Junior $30,000 - $45,000
This setup ensures a well-rounded approach, allowing for extensive project management while catering to a variety of tasks across different experience levels.
4.1 Project-Based Contracts for Junior Developers $15,000 - $30,000 per project
A junior developer can execute a defined scope of work, which is budget-friendly for smaller projects.
4.2 Contractual Engagements for Mid-Level Developers $30,000 - $50,000 per project
This structure allows for scalability, where the mid-level developer’s skill set supports project growth while remaining cost-effective.
4.3 Contractual Engagements for Senior Developers $50,000 - $80,000+ per project
A senior developer can lead large projects with high complexity and visibility. Their costs reflect their ability to ensure successful project outcomes.
Finding the right talent is crucial for your project’s success. Here’s how to write an effective job post to hire Beego developers.
Have more questions? Contact our support team to get what you need. connect@sourcebae.com
A Beego developer specializes in using the Beego framework, which is a powerful and efficient web application framework for the Go programming language. This framework provides a robust set of features, including an MVC architecture, built-in ORM, and a comprehensive set of tools for routing, session management, and RESTful API development. Beego developers are skilled in creating scalable and high-performance web applications, leveraging Go's concurrency features for optimal performance. They are also adept at utilizing Beego's extensive documentation and community support to solve complex problems and implement best practices. Overall, a Beego developer plays a crucial role in modern web development projects.